By Dino-Ray Ramos Associate Editor/Reporter The Alamo Drafthouse Cinema has announced an emergency relief fund for its furloughed staff as a result of COVID-19.

They will receive a supplemental two weeks’ worth of pay and their health coverage will be covered through the end of April.

The current pandemic has prompted Dratfhouse founders Tim and Karrie League to create a new relief in partnership with the Emergency Assistance Foundation.

This is seeded with $2 million dollars from their Alamo Community Fund. There is currently an Alamo Family Fund portal open for donations.
